Plugin Directory

Changeset 1101431


Ignore:
Timestamp:
02/27/2015 07:49:01 PM (11 years ago)
Author:
Varrcan
Message:

Fix small bugs

Location:
mfp-mod-wp/trunk
Files:
4 edited

Legend:

Unmodified
Added
Removed
  • mfp-mod-wp/trunk/class/option.class.php

    r1099732 r1101431  
    1212 
    1313  public function __construct(){
    14         $this->mfp_options = unserialize($this->mfpGetOptions());
    15        
    1614    if(get_option('mfp_version') == null){
    1715      $this->delOldSetting();
     16            $this->mfpReset();
    1817      add_option('mfp_version', MFP_VERSION);
     18            $mfp_options = array("mfp_mod_option_link" => array(
     19                                                                                                         "rss" => "0",
     20                                                                                                         "wlwmanifest" => "0",
     21                                                                                                         "index_rel" => "0",
     22                                                                                                         "wp_shortlink" => "0",
     23                                                                                                         "wp_generator" => "0",
     24                                                                                                        ), // Чистка head от мусора
     25                                                    "mfp_mod_option_comment" => "0", // Удаление комментариев html
     26                                                    "mfp_mod_option_version" => "0", // Удаление версии
     27                                                    "mfp_mod_option_wp_help" => "0", // Удаление контекстного меню справки
     28                                                    "mfp_mod_option_wp_del" => "0", // Удаление лого и ссылок wp в админке
     29                                                    "mfp_mod_option_wp_logo" => "0", // Свое лого при входе в админку
     30                                                    "mfp_mod_option_wp_widgets" => array(
     31                                                                                                         "quick_press" => "0",
     32                                                                                                         "activity" => "0",
     33                                                                                                         "right_now" => "0",
     34                                                                                                         "primary" => "0",
     35                                                                                                         "welcome" => "0",
     36                                                                                                        ), // Удаление виджетов
     37                                                    "mfp_mod_option_wp_translit" => "0", // Транслит
     38                                                    "mfp_mod_option_footer_text_opt" => "0", // Текст в футере
     39                                                    "mfp_mod_option_footer_text" => "Developed by", // Надпись в футере
     40                                                    "mfp_mod_option_footer_text1" => "https://varrcan.me/", // Ссылка в футере
     41                                                    "mfp_mod_option_footer_text2" => "Varrcan.ME", // Подпись к ссылке
     42                                                    "mfp_mod_option_metabox" => "0", // Метабокс
     43                                                    "mfp_mod_option_metabox_title" => "", // Заголовок Метабокса
     44                                                    "mfp_mod_option_metabox_text" => "", // Текст Метабокса
     45                                                    "mfp_mod_option_custom_admin" => "0" // Страница входа
     46                                                    );
     47            $mfp_options = serialize($mfp_options);
     48            // Добавление в БД значения по умолчанию
     49            add_option("mfp_mod_options", "$mfp_options");
    1950    }
     51       
     52        if(get_option('mfp_version') < MFP_VERSION){
     53            update_option('mfp_version', MFP_VERSION);
     54        }
     55       
     56        $this->mfp_options = unserialize($this->mfpGetOptions());
    2057       
    2158        $this->functionMFP(); // инициализация функций
     
    312349            //add_action('login_message', array(&$this, 'custom_login_form')); // Сообщение над формой
    313350            //add_action('login_footer', array(&$this, 'custom_login_footer')); // Футтер
    314             //add_filter('login_headerurl', function(){ return get_home_url();}); // Смена ссылки с wordpress.org на главную сайта
    315             //add_filter('login_headertitle', function(){ return false;}); // Удаление title логотипа
     351            add_filter('login_headerurl', create_function('', 'return get_home_url();')); // Смена ссылки с wordpress.org на главную сайта
     352            add_filter('login_headertitle', create_function('', 'return false;')); // Удаление title логотипа
    316353        }
    317354  }
  • mfp-mod-wp/trunk/mfp-mod-wp.php

    r1099681 r1101431  
    2424define('MFP_MOD_WP_DIR', plugin_dir_path(__FILE__));
    2525define('MFP_MOD_WP_URL', plugin_dir_url(__FILE__));
    26 define('MFP_VERSION', '0.3.2');
     26define('MFP_VERSION', '0.3.3');
    2727
    2828if(function_exists('load_plugin_textdomain')) load_plugin_textdomain('mfp-languages', PLUGINDIR.'/'.dirname(plugin_basename
  • mfp-mod-wp/trunk/readme.txt

    r1099744 r1101431  
    1717Attention! Some options may cause unstable operation of your blog. If its so, then turn off the option or do not use the plugin, if you do not sure. The plugin don't change your files, if it will be deactivated, that all settings will be reset.
    1818
     19-----------------------------------
     20
     21Плагин MFP мод WP чистит ваш исходный код от ссылок, которые могут замедлить работу блога, скрывает с админки некоторые пункты, в частности, версию движка, ссылки на wordpress.org и т.д. Позволяет добавить в Консоль свой виджет, изменить текст в футере админ панели, изменить фоновое изображение и логотип страницы входа. Автоматически переводит в транскрипт имена загружаемых файлов, ссылок на новые записи и страницы.
     22
     23Возможности плагина постоянно расширяются
     24
     25Внимание! Некоторые опции могут вызвать нестабильную работу вашего блога. В этом случае отключите опцию, либо откажитесь от использования данного плагина, если вы в чем-то не уверены. Сам плагин физически не изменяет ваши файлы, после деактивации все настройки будут сброшены.
     26
    1927== Installation ==
    2028
     
    3442
    3543== Changelog ==
     44
     45= v0.3.3 (27.02.2015) =
     46* Fix small bugs
     47* Fix readme.txt
    3648
    3749= v0.3.2 (26.02.2015) =
     
    5466== Upgrade notice ==
    5567
     68* v0.3.3 Fix small bugs
    5669* v0.3.2 Full Updated
    5770* v0.3 Updated translation En, Ru
  • mfp-mod-wp/trunk/view.php

    r1099681 r1101431  
    320320        </div><br/>
    321321        <div class="clearfloat">
     322          <input class="button-secondary" value="X" type="button" title="Очистить"
     323                 onclick="document.getElementById('image_url').value='';">
    322324          <input type="text" name="mfp_image_url" id="image_url" class="regular-text"
    323325                 placeholder="<?php echo __('background image', 'mfp-languages'); ?>"
     
    327329        </div>
    328330        <div class="clearfloat">
     331          <input class="button-secondary" value="X" type="button" title="Очистить"
     332                 onclick="document.getElementById('logo_url').value='';">
    329333          <input type="text" name="mfp_logo_url" id="logo_url" class="regular-text"
    330334                 placeholder="<?php echo __('logo', 'mfp-languages'); ?>"
Note: See TracChangeset for help on using the changeset viewer.